Gracia Otta

Jurnal DIKMAS 2023 Biro Pengelolaan Penelitian dan Pengabdian Kepada Masyarat SETIA Ngabang

This community service aims to increase interest and skills in reading aloud in English as well as interpretation skills and English vocabulary when reading Bible verses for Sunday School children who are also students in elementary and secondary schools. The method used in this service was by paying attention to the voice, intonation, and stress appropriately followed by understanding the meaning of the reading by the reader through a Bible reading competition in English. The results of this service showed that the Sunday School children were eagerly and enthusiastically able to take part in the competition to read aloud Bible verses, although gradually they need to be trained again how to read aloud with the right voice, intonation, stress, and pronunciation of English words. 

Elfin Warnius Waruwu; Mortan Sibarani

Sinar Kasih: Jurnal Pendidikan Agama dan Filsafat 2023 Sekolah Tinggi Teologi Injili Arastamar (SETIA) Ngabang

This study aims to analyze the philosophy of Christian education related to the vision and mission of Christian religious education teachers in the context of an independent curriculum. The main focus of this study is to introduce the basic concepts and principles of Christian education philosophy that are relevant to understanding the vision and mission of Christian religious education teachers. This study also identifies the contribution of Christian educational philosophy to the development of an independent Christian curriculum. This study uses a descriptive analysis method to study the relevant concepts and principles of Christian education philosophy. Various theoretical sources, such as Christian educational philosophy literature and the Bible, are used to support the analysis. This research reveals that the vision and mission of Christian religious education teachers emphasize the recognition of God's divinity, love as the main principle, the integration of faith and knowledge, the formation of Christian character, and the spiritual dimension of education. In implementing their vision and mission, Christian religious education teachers can use content selection that supports Christian values, integrated teaching strategies, and relevant assessments. In this way, they can create learning experiences that reflect their vision and mission and help students develop strong Christian character.

Alo Jakaria

Jurnal Pendidikan Agama dan Teologi 2023 International Forum of Researchers and Lecturers

Social media has become an important part of modern human life and has influenced various aspects of life, including religion. In the context of the Christian faith, social media can be used as a medium for teaching and spreading religious messages. The purpose of this research is to explore the effectiveness of social media as a medium for teaching Christian faith. This research was conducted by surveying social media users who follow Christian accounts and are active in participating in online religious activities. Respondents were given a questionnaire to assess their experience in using social media as a medium for teaching Christian faith, including the type of content they liked and their level of involvement in online religious activities. The results of this study indicate that social media can be effective as a medium for teaching Christian faith. Respondents indicated that they had high levels of involvement in online religious activities and that they preferred to obtain religious information and teaching through social media rather than traditional sources such as books or seminars. The types of content most liked by respondents were quotes from the Bible, teaching videos, and personal religious experiences. However, this research also shows that the effectiveness of social media as a medium for teaching Christian faith can be influenced by various factors, such as the quality of the content and the user's trust in information sources. Therefore, there needs to be continuous monitoring and evaluation of content posted on social media so that the religious messages conveyed can be well received by social media users.

Lestari Br Silaban; Flesia Nanda Uli Boangmanalu; Anessa Mei Pasaribu; Herdiana Boru Hombing

Jurnal Teologi Injili dan Pendidikan Agama 2023 Sekolah Tinggi Pastoral Kateketik Santo Fransiskus Assisi

God sent Jonah to warn the people of Nineveh. Nineveh will be overthrown by God because of the great sin they have committed. However, Nineveh had repented to God, so God did not overturn the city and God loved Nineveh. From this incident, the prophet Jonah was angry with God because God loves Nineveh, and Jonah wanted the salvation that God gave only for the Israelites. In the present context, there are also Christians who have the same thoughts as the prophet Jonah, who think that religions other than Christianity are not religions that are loved by God. The purpose of this research is to show that God's love is universal and He forgives the mistakes of all those who repent and to guide the prophet Jonah and Christians who think that God's salvation or love is only for the nation of Israel and Christians is wrong thinking. The research method used is a qualitative research method and a critical historical approach in the text of Jonah 4:1-11 with the steps of literal translation, comparison of literal translations and the Indonesian Bible Institute (LAI). The results of this research are that God has proven that He loves all nations who have returned to their ways and also that God guided the prophet Jonah about his erroneous thoughts, namely through castor trees and caterpillars.
